Start Your Blog Today: A Beginner's Complete Guide
Starting a blog might seem intimidating, but it's easier than ever to share your thoughts, expertise, and passion with the world. Whether you want to document your journey, build an audience, or establish yourself as an authority in your field, this guide will walk you through everything you need to know.
Choose Your Platform
The first step is selecting a blogging platform that fits your needs. Popular options include WordPress, Medium, Substack, and Wix. Consider factors like ease of use, customization options, and whether you want to self-host or use a managed solution. WordPress offers maximum flexibility, while Medium and Substack are great for beginners who want to start writing immediately without technical setup.
Define Your Niche and Audience
Before you publish your first post, think about what you want to write about and who you're writing for. Your niche doesn't have to be narrow, but having a general direction helps attract consistent readers. Are you writing about personal finance, travel, technology, or lifestyle? Understanding your audience helps you tailor your content to their interests and needs.
Set Up Your Blog
Once you've chosen a platform, create an account and customize your blog's appearance. Add a compelling header image, write a clear "About" page that tells readers who you are, and organize your categories. Make sure your blog is mobile-friendly and loads quickly—these factors matter for both readers and search engines.
Create a Content Plan
Consistency is key to building an engaged audience. Plan your posting schedule—whether that's weekly, bi-weekly, or monthly—and stick to it. Create a list of 10-15 post ideas before you launch. This gives you a head start and prevents the dreaded blank page syndrome.
Write Your First Post
Don't overthink it. Your first post should introduce your blog's purpose and give readers a reason to come back. Focus on providing value, whether that's information, entertainment, or inspiration. Use clear headings, short paragraphs, and images to break up text and keep readers engaged.
Promote and Grow
Share your posts on social media, engage with other bloggers in your niche, and be patient. Building an audience takes time, but consistency and quality content will eventually pay off. The most important thing is to start—your voice matters, and your first reader is waiting.
